Transaction 9396780538876af656ccb166fcdd3e776cdc00d51c978da5ae376417c23ed1a7
1 Input
1 Output
-
9396780538876af656ccb166fcdd3e776cdc00d51c978da5ae376417c23ed1a7:0
- value
- 74186
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c4e0512f0dd4e0548ee958f8aad1c9324f604b9
- address
- bc1qp38q2yhsm48q2j8wjk8c4tgujvj0vp9eu2gqan